''Papi'' is Belgian-French-Ugandan film that was written and directed by Belgian writer and director Kjell Clarysse. The film was shot on a shoestring budget of $15,000 (about Shs 54.5m) on location in Kampala, Belgium and France in 2015 but still got a successful premier in Belgium in 2017. It premiered in Uganda in February 2018.
